The City of Hillsboro Plein Air Event ended today with a reception and award ceremony at the Walters Cultural Arts Center. My oil painting won 2nd Place in the Landscape division; it was painted at Jackson Bottom Wetlands. It was a good event and weather conditions were near perfect most of the time. About 40 artists participated. Many of us knew each other and I want to thank those who walked by me as I was painting, and offered words of encouragement. There were 3 painting categories: Landscape, Cityscape, and a Quick Draw Figurative, and all of the submitted paintings were excellent. Kitty Wallis, in the photo with me, was the judge. Hillsboro Plein Air Event July 17, 2010

My 24"x18" oil painting won First Place in the figurative category at the Hillsboro Plein Air event. The judge was Thomas Kitts.
